I have a 2011 Ford F250 CNG van. Has 2 tanks, I dont know the capacity but I believe its 20 "gallons" on the pump, and the pump displays "gasoline gallon equivalent" or about 5.66 lbs of CNG. I watch the odometer religiously as getting Dr Hook to take you in is a major gaff. I start planning to head for 1 of 2 stations here in Long Beach at about 118 city miles and I am panicking at 138 miles (once). When I looked under the van at the pressure gauge at 138 miles, I was down to 500 psi from a 3600 psi tank at %100 fill. Trouble is the guage is very sketchy. Itll show 1/3 of a tank and 5 minutes later itll be pegged on E. I dont know if they ported the pressure to fuel gauge over correctly but I have learned not to trust the gas guage. Its 2.22 a GGE here so I dont understand how the poor mileage equates to CNG if we are talking 2.22 for an equal amount of energy as a gallon of gasoline? Ive never run it "dry" so I dont know actual mpg Im getting. Id do it in a heartbeat as I know where all the stations are but not for my road trip car.
